core/tests/fixtures/homekit_controller/mysa_living.json

250 lines
8.6 KiB
JSON

[
{
"aid": 1,
"primary": true,
"services": [
{
"type": "0000004A-0000-1000-8000-0026BB765291",
"primary": true,
"iid": 20,
"characteristics": [
{
"type": "00000023-0000-1000-8000-0026BB765291",
"format": "string",
"value": "Thermostat",
"perms": [
"pr"
],
"iid": 24
},
{
"type": "00000010-0000-1000-8000-0026BB765291",
"format": "float",
"minValue": 0,
"maxValue": 100,
"stepValue": 1,
"value": 40,
"iid": 27,
"unit": "percentage",
"perms": [
"pr",
"ev"
]
},
{
"type": "0000000F-0000-1000-8000-0026BB765291",
"value": 0,
"minValue": 0,
"maxValue": 2,
"stepValue": 1,
"format": "uint8",
"perms": [
"pr",
"ev"
],
"iid": 21
},
{
"type": "00000033-0000-1000-8000-0026BB765291",
"value": 0,
"minValue": 0,
"maxValue": 3,
"stepValue": 1,
"format": "uint8",
"perms": [
"pr",
"pw",
"ev"
],
"iid": 22
},
{
"type": "00000011-0000-1000-8000-0026BB765291",
"value": 24.1,
"minValue": 0,
"maxValue": 100,
"stepValue": 0.1,
"unit": "celsius",
"format": "float",
"perms": [
"pr",
"ev"
],
"iid": 25
},
{
"type": "00000035-0000-1000-8000-0026BB765291",
"value": 22,
"minValue": 5,
"maxValue": 30,
"stepValue": 0.1,
"unit": "celsius",
"format": "float",
"perms": [
"pr",
"pw",
"ev"
],
"iid": 23
},
{
"type": "00000036-0000-1000-8000-0026BB765291",
"format": "uint8",
"minValue": 0,
"maxValue": 1,
"stepValue": 1,
"value": 0,
"iid": 26,
"perms": [
"pr",
"pw",
"ev"
]
}
]
},
{
"type": "0000003E-0000-1000-8000-0026BB765291",
"iid": 1,
"characteristics": [
{
"type": "00000014-0000-1000-8000-0026BB765291",
"perms": [
"pw"
],
"iid": 2,
"format": "bool"
},
{
"type": "00000020-0000-1000-8000-0026BB765291",
"format": "string",
"value": "Empowered Homes Inc.",
"perms": [
"pr"
],
"iid": 3
},
{
"type": "00000021-0000-1000-8000-0026BB765291",
"format": "string",
"value": "v1",
"perms": [
"pr"
],
"iid": 4
},
{
"type": "00000023-0000-1000-8000-0026BB765291",
"format": "string",
"value": "Mysa-85dda9",
"perms": [
"pr"
],
"iid": 5
},
{
"type": "00000030-0000-1000-8000-0026BB765291",
"format": "string",
"value": "AAAAAAA000",
"perms": [
"pr"
],
"iid": 6
},
{
"type": "00000052-0000-1000-8000-0026BB765291",
"format": "string",
"value": "2.8.1",
"perms": [
"pr"
],
"iid": 7
},
{
"hidden": true,
"type": "22280E2C-9B79-43BD-8370-5A8F67777B29",
"format": "string",
"value": "b4e62d85dda9",
"perms": [
"pr"
],
"iid": 8
}
]
},
{
"type": "000000A2-0000-1000-8000-0026BB765291",
"iid": 10,
"characteristics": [
{
"type": "00000037-0000-1000-8000-0026BB765291",
"format": "string",
"value": "1.1.0",
"perms": [
"pr"
],
"iid": 11
}
]
},
{
"type": "00000043-0000-1000-8000-0026BB765291",
"iid": 40,
"characteristics": [
{
"type": "00000025-0000-1000-8000-0026BB765291",
"format": "bool",
"value": 0,
"perms": [
"pr",
"pw",
"ev"
],
"iid": 42
},
{
"type": "00000023-0000-1000-8000-0026BB765291",
"format": "string",
"value": "Display",
"perms": [
"pr"
],
"iid": 41
},
{
"type": "00000008-0000-1000-8000-0026BB765291",
"format": "int",
"minValue": 0,
"maxValue": 100,
"stepValue": 1,
"value": 0,
"iid": 43,
"unit": "percentage",
"perms": [
"pr",
"pw",
"ev"
]
}
]
},
{
"type": "3354EC82-AF38-4755-B4A4-4DB8E418F555",
"iid": 50,
"characteristics": [
{
"hidden": true,
"type": "E71D8348-BB33-4C34-8C50-A64B1136EDD2",
"format": "bool",
"value": 0,
"perms": [
"pr",
"pw"
],
"iid": 51
}
]
}
]
}
]